Abstract:
Method to detect cloned software being used on a client user unit. An initialization phase comprises: defining a tag value as being equal to an initial random value, opening a new record storing the tag value and introducing the tag value into the client user unit. An operating phase comprises: preparing a client message comprising the request and a value depending on the tag value; sending the client message to the server; and checking if the tag value of the client message is correct with respect to the stored tag value. If they do not match, the requested service is denied. If they do match, the method sends a server message to the user unit; updates the tag value with a new tag value; and stores the new tag value on the server and user unit.
